Monroe man wounded in shooting along Centennial Trail

Published 1:30 am Thursday, December 19, 2019

SNOHOMISH — A shooting left a man with a bullet wound to the arm Wednesday night near Snohomish.

Deputies believe the Monroe man, 27, had set up a drug deal over Snapchat, with a plan to meet at a parking lot along the Centennial Trail. He was sitting in the vehicle around 8:30 p.m. in the 5800 block of South Machias Road when he was shot through the driver’s window, according to the Snohomish County Sheriff’s Office.

An ambulance took the injured man to Providence Regional Medical Center Everett.

The suspect fled.

Two shotgun shell casings were recovered at the trailhead.

Detectives continued to investigate Thursday.
